Prove that cot2θ × sec2θ = cot2θ + 1.

सिद्धांत
Advertisements

उत्तर

L.H.S. = cot2θ × sec2θ

= `(cos^2θ)/(sin^2θ) xx 1/(cos^2θ)`

= `1/(sin^2θ)`

= cosec2θ

= 1 + cot2θ   ...[∵ 1 + cot2θ = cosec2θ]

= R.H.S.

∴ cot2θ × sec2θ = cot2θ + 1
